Jefferies Group LLC, the largest independent, global, full-service investment banking firm headquartered in the U.S. focused on serving clients for 60 years, is a leader in providing insight, expertise and execution to investors, companies and governments. We offer deep sector expertise across a full range of products and services in investment banking, equities, fixed income, asset and wealth management in the Americas, Europe and the Middle East and Asia. Jefferies Group LLC is a wholly-owned subsidiary of Jefferies Financial Group Inc. (NYSE: JEF), a diversified financial services company.

Jefferies Restructuring Team is expanding, and we are looking for an Analyst to be based in our London office. A Analyst in Financial Restructuring would work on a variety of transactions within the group, including debtor- and creditor-side restructurings and distressed mergers and acquisitions.
Jefferies a unique opportunity for associates to work on projects that provide exposure to a wide variety of financial advisory and investment banking products and industries.
Key Responsibilities & Tasks
The successful individual will be responsible for structuring and executing transactions, and typically functions as a backup for relationships with important clients, is generally the key contact for some clients, and begins to assume some important new business responsibilities
